**Comprehensive English Lesson for Beginners: Session 2**

**Session Objective:** Introduce basic vocabulary related to numbers and colors, and focus on
practicing listening, speaking, vocabulary, grammar, and writing skills.

**Session Duration:** 60 minutes

**Materials Needed:**

1. Flashcards with images representing numbers and colors

2. Whiteboard and markers

3. Printed worksheets with vocabulary and grammar exercises

4. Audio resources for listening practice

5. Colored pencils or markers for an activity

6. Pen and paper for writing exercises

**Session Plan:**

**Introduction (5 minutes):**

1. Welcome the learners and briefly recap the previous session's content.

2. Discuss the goals for the current session: learning numbers, colors, and basic grammar usage.

**Vocabulary and Listening - Numbers (15 minutes):**

1. Introduce numbers from 1 to 20 using flashcards and pronunciation.

2. Play an audio clip with numbers spoken out loud to practice listening and pronunciation.

3. Have learners repeat after the audio to practice speaking.

**Vocabulary and Listening - Colors (10 minutes):**

1. Introduce basic colors: red, blue, green, yellow, etc.

2. Display flashcards with corresponding color images and pronunciation.


3. Play an audio clip with color names for listening practice.

**Speaking and Practice - Numbers and Colors (10 minutes):**

1. Engage learners in a number and color recognition game:

- Call out a number or color, and learners raise the corresponding flashcard or colored marker.

- This activity reinforces both vocabulary and listening skills.

**Grammar Explanation - "Is" and "Are" (10 minutes):**

1. Write "is" and "are" on the whiteboard.

2. Explain that "is" is used with singular subjects, and "are" is used with plural subjects.

3. Provide example sentences for clarification.

4. Practice forming sentences using "is" and "are" with numbers and colors.

**Grammar Practice (10 minutes):**

1. Distribute worksheets with sentences missing "is" or "are."

2. Instruct learners to complete the sentences with the appropriate form.

3. Review the answers together.

**Writing Exercise (5 minutes):**

1. Ask learners to write sentences describing objects using colors and the appropriate form of "is" or
"are."

2. Encourage creativity and accuracy.

**Listening Comprehension (5 minutes):**

1. Play a short audio clip with descriptions of objects using numbers and colors.

2. Ask comprehension questions to ensure understanding.

**Conclusion (5 minutes):**

1. Summarize the key vocabulary and grammar concepts covered.


2. Highlight the importance of numbers and colors in everyday communication.

3. Mention that the next session will focus on introducing basic vocabulary related to family and
relationships.

**Final Remarks (5 minutes):**

1. Thank the learners for their participation and effort.

2. Provide positive feedback and encouragement.

3. Remind learners to practice numbers, colors, and the use of "is" and "are" in their daily interactions.

**Note:** Customize the activities based on the learners' progress and preferences. Maintain an
interactive and supportive environment to enhance learners' language skills and confidence.
